About this listen
In this episode, we speak with Dr. Barbara Atkinson, founding Dean of the Kirk Kerkorian School of Medicine at UNLV, about her career and the development of the medical school.
Dr. Atkinson discusses what she is most proud of, including building a medical school focused on community, diversity, and service, and educating students who want to make a difference. She talks about her early interest in science, her experience as a woman in academic medicine, and the process of starting a medical school from the ground up.
The conversation also covers public health, bioethics, changes in medical education, and how new technologies like AI may affect the future of medicine.
